Women’s shoe brands, fast fashion retailers and foot care accessory distributors constantly face mass negative feedback linked to ill-fitting high heels. Generic thin heel pads lose rebound after short wear, fail to fully wrap the heel curve, peel off during walking and cannot resolve dual pain points of shoe slippage and heel blisters at the same time. Many low-density foam liners harden after sweat soaking, triggering foot soreness and one-star ratings on cross-border retail platforms. 1. Full 180° arc wrapping eliminates partial friction blisters from single-sided thin pads

Most budget heel liners only cover a narrow strip of the heel rear, leaving left and right heel edges exposed to constant friction with shoe lining during walking, which quickly forms painful blisters for long-time high-heel users. This foam liner adopts ergonomic 4D curved molding to fully enclose the entire heel outline, expanding anti-abrasion contact area without bulging inside slim pointed pumps. Even after all-day standing and commuting, the lining evenly disperses friction pressure, drastically reducing consumer complaints about heel skin damage and blisters posted on Amazon, Shopify and other cross-border stores.

2. High-density resilient sponge avoids rapid collapse after repeated sweat exposure

Low-cost low-density foam heel pads flatten permanently after absorbing foot sweat, losing cushioning and slip-resistance within 1–2 days of use, forcing buyers to repeatedly repurchase cheap liners. The customized sponge raw material for this liner maintains consistent rebound performance under long-term sweat contact, never sinking flat or hardening after dozens of wear cycles. Continuous shock absorption relieves heel pressure from stiletto heels, effectively alleviating fatigue for office ladies, event staff and retail workers who stand for hours daily and raising product repeat purchase rates for distributors.
